Billingsley's control and velocity are off as he lasts only 2 1/3 innings against the Washington Nationals. The Dodgers use a three-run ninth inning to win, 7-4. A scheduled second game is rained out.Reporting from Washington — Chad Billingsley insisted he isn't hurt and Manager Don Mattingly said there are no signs that anything is physically wrong with the Dodgers right-hander— no skipped bullpen sessions, no visits to the trainer's room.
